High quality CdSeS nanocrystals synthesized by facile single injection process and their electroluminescence
Eunjoo Jang1, Shinae Jun, Lyongsun Pu
1Electronic Materials LAB, Samsung Advanced Institute of Technology, Mt.14-1, Nongseo-Ri, Giheung-Eup, Yongin-Si, Gyeonggi-Do, 449-712 Korea. ejjang12@samsung.com
Abstract:
Highly luminescent CdSeS nanocrystals (quantum efficiency up to 85%), showing tunable luminescence properties from red to blue region with narrow band edge (FWHM = 34 nm), were synthesized by one-step addition of Se and S source mixture into the Cd precursor solution at elevated temperature, and the resulting nanocrystals were successfully embedded in a traditional OLED structure to give spectrally clean and narrow electroluminescence emission at identical positions of the photoluminescence spectrum.
